The best area to stay in Glengarriff is within the village centre itself, as it offers the most convenience and access to local amenities.The village centre is compact and picturesque, located at the head of Glengarriff Harbour. The main road, the N71, runs through it, with most shops, pubs, and restaurants situated along this stretch or just off it. From here, you can easily access the pier for boat trips to Garnish Island or explore the Glengarriff Woods Nature Reserve, which is just a short walk away.For couples, staying in the village centre is ideal. You'll find a selection of hotels and guesthouses within walking distance of eateries offering local cuisine and traditional music. It's also a great base for exploring the Beara Peninsula's stunning scenery, with many scenic drives starting right from the village.Families will also appreciate the village centre's convenience. Being centrally located means easy access to local attractions like the Bamboo Park and the nearby playground.
